HQP Series High Peak Power Laser
HQP Series high peak power Sub-nanosecond lasers are solid state lasers(DPSS lasers) based upon MC series of Sub-nanosecond microchip seed laser and diode pump amplifier, passively Q-switched lasers. This series of products are all-solid-state lasers based adopt MOPA structure(MOPA Lasers) independently developed by Reallight. HQP Series includes two wavelengths of 1064nm and 532nm. The pulse duration(pulse width) can go down to 750ps(0.75ns), therefore it is also called as a kind of picosecond laser . Various models operate with repetition rates up to 10kHz, peak power up to 650kW. Such series lasers are suitable for Laser Mapping(survey and draw) Especially the wavelength of 532nm can be applied to Laser ocean mapping(Laser marine surveying) and Laser Seafloor mapping(Laser seabed mapping).
